M4 Recruitment (Heathrow) are currently recruiting for a Class 2 HIAB Driver on behalf of a well-established roofing builders merchant based in Surbiton.
Job Details:
- Position: Class 2 HIAB Driver
- Location: High Wycombe
- Salary: £45,000 per annum
- Hours: Monday to Friday, 07:30 - 16:30
- Overtime: Occasional Saturday shifts available
- Employment Type: Full-time, permanent
